Brad Paisley Pays Tribute To Sen. John McCain

"When I Get Where I'm Going,"

Brad Paisley is paying tribute to the late U.S. Senator John McCain. During a show in Bristow, Virginia Saturday night.

Brad sang his 2005 hit, "When I Get Where I'm Going," and then he tipped his hat to an image of the American war hero that was projected on the jumbo screen.

 

The tribute brought the audience to their feet.

McCain, a Navy airman and long-time Arizona Senator, died Saturday at the age of 81 following a battle with brain cancer.
